Abstract:
This present study, based on unseen archives, examines the long-term history of two Lyon-based cooperative worker production societies (SCOP) from an economic point of view, leaving aside political issues. To understand how these SCOP have lasted so long (80 and 133 years), we have analyzed their accounting, to find the way they operate. The sources of their success come mainly from the fact that they obtain municipal public contracts, and we present two illustrative cases : the first concerns the Association Typographique Lyonnaise (ATL), in the printing sector, and the se- cond, the Cooperative Workers' Production Company L'Avenir, with the construction of social housing (Part 2). Legislation, will be used as a framework of intelligibility (Part 1) to situate the access by the SCOP to these very specific markets that are public procurement.
